Description
Registered Nurse (OB/L&D) - Minnesota, Bemidji
Contract Length
- 13 weeks
Required Qualifications
- Minimum 2 years OB/L&D nursing experience, including postpartum care
- Active Minnesota RN license (temporary or pending licenses considered with potential start date adjustments)
- Current BLS (AHA), ACLS (AHA), and NRP certifications required; PALS preferred
- Experience with EPIC or other EMR systems
- Ability to work in Labor and Postpartum units
- Willingness to float to Med-Surg and Telemetry units as needed
Job Responsibilities
- Provide care for postpartum, stable antepartum, newborns, gynecology patients, and Med-Surg overflow
- May serve as second RN in Special Care Nursery (SCN)
- Assist with circulating duties in Labor & Delivery (a plus)
- Float primarily as helping hands; expected to take Med-Surg patients occasionally
Work Schedule
- 12-hour shifts, rotating day and night
- Includes weekends
- Assist in filling schedule vacancies due to onboarding, staff vacancies, or FMLA
Patient Load & Support Staff
- Average daily census: 5 mom/baby couplets, 2 pediatrics, 1 gynecology, 2 labor, 4 SCN patients
- Support staff includes ward clerk (7am-7pm), CNA (Tues-Thurs), charge nurse/circulator, resource nurse, and LPN scrub nurse without assignments
- Nurse-to-patient ratios follow AWHONN standards:
- 1:3 mom/baby couplets
- 1:5 gynecology/Med-Surg patients
- 1:3-4 pediatrics
Orientation & Unit Information
- Equipment and unit orientation provided on first day
- Equipment used: EPIC One Chart, Omnicell, Philips Vitals Machines, Bladder Scanner, Medula Breast Pumps, Responder 5 Call Light System, Medfusion Pumps
- All clinicians must badge in and out at the facility
- Scrub color: Navy Blue
Additional Notes
- Candidates living within 80 miles of the facility are considered local
- Must disclose if previously employed by this health system; prior employment requires a minimum 6-month gap before rehire

About Bemidji, MN
As a Travel Labor and Delivery Nurse in Bemidji, MN here's what you should know:- Bemidji's cost of living is slightly l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
- Wages generally match up with the lower cost of living.
- Average summer highs are around 79°F, and winter lows can drop to about 1°F.
- Be prepared for cold winters and mild summers.
- Short term rentals may be a bit limited, but there are options available.
- It's recommended to start the search early to secure furnished housing.
- Bemidji is car-friendly, and public transportation options are limited.
- Having a car is essential for getting around the area.
- Bemidji has a diverse community with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include seasonal affective disorder (SAD) due to the long winters.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ses in the area.
- Bemidji offers a variety of out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, and boating.
- There are also local restaurants, art galleries, and music venues to explore.
- Sports enthusiasts can enjoy hockey and other winter activities.
